Posts Tagged ‘Delphi’

  • Home
  • Posts Tagged ‘Delphi’

Delphi — the centre of the world with Picture-Perfect Views

History lovers are attracted to Delphi because it’s an ancient town, and that’s just for starters. It was first inhabited in late Mycenaean times as far back as the 15th century BC.  It’s the seat of the most important Greek temple and oracle of Apollo. It is most intriguing to...

Get the best of Greece and Europe travel ideas and tips delivered to your inbox.